Located in Redmond, Washington, DigiPen Institute of Technology is a private college that offers undergraduate degree programs in Computer Science, Game Design, Digital Audio and Music, Computer Engineering, and Digital Art and Animation, as well as Master’s degree programs in Computer Science and Digital Art. DigiPen Institute of Technology has been ranked one of the top 5 game design schools in the country by the Princeton Review for more than a decade.

Interdisciplinary Team Projects are a cornerstone of the DigiPen experience and play a central role in the curriculum, fostering the collaborative production environment that defines the institution's approach to education. Through these projects, students work alongside peers from a variety of disciplines to tackle complex challenges, develop innovative solutions, and gain meaningful, real-world production experience. This hands‑on, team-based approach helps students build the communication, collaboration, problem‑solving, and project management skills essential for success in both their academic pursuits and future careers.
